Court infrastructure

Court infrastructure
Trial court
Rockingham County Superior Court
Judges
4 (New Hampshire Superior Court Justice — approximate primary/resident assignment per county branch. NH has ~24 Justices statewide who rotate assignments among the 10 county branches under a unified bench (RSA § 491), so any given trial day's working bench may differ from this count. Hillsborough County uniquely operates two branches (Manchester / North and Nashua / South). Vintage 2026 courts.nh.gov roster.)
Court seats
Brentwood

About this profile

This profile aggregates publicly available U.S. government statistics for Rockingham County, New Hampshire to give trial attorneys venue context for jury selection. It describes the general population of the county, not the qualified jury wheel, and is not legal advice or a substitute for the court's juror records.
